Paediatric airway management: What is new?
S Ramesh1, R Jayanthi, S R Archana
1Department of Anaesthesia, Kanchi Kamkoti Child Trust Hospital, Chennai, Tamil Nadu, India.
Recent advancements in paediatric anaesthesia have revolutionized airway management. New devices like supraglottic airway devices and video laryngoscopes improve outcomes for challenging paediatric airways.

Main Results:
- Supraglottic airway devices are now standard in operating rooms for routine procedures.
- Fibreoptic and video laryngoscopes offer solutions for difficult paediatric airway situations.
- New algorithms and procedures like Ex Utero Intrapartum Treatment (EXIT) are improving neonatal airway management.
Conclusions:
- Continuous updates in knowledge and device utilization are essential for effective paediatric airway management.
- Modern airway devices and techniques have significantly improved safety and efficacy in paediatric anaesthesia.
- The management of paediatric and neonatal airways has been transformed by technological and procedural innovations.
